Supporting Bone Health and Reducing Osteoporosis Risk

Estrogen plays a critical role in maintaining bone density, and its decline during menopause can accelerate bone loss. BHRT helps replenish estrogen levels, which contributes to preserving bone strength and reducing the risk of osteoporosis and fractures. This protective effect is a key component of maintaining long-term musculoskeletal health in women.

Integrating Hormone Pellet Therapy for Consistent Hormonal Support

Hormone pellet therapy is an innovative BHRT delivery method gaining popularity for its convenience and efficacy. Small, bioidentical hormone pellets are implanted subcutaneously, releasing a steady dose of hormones over several months. This approach eliminates the need for daily pills or creams, ensuring consistent hormone levels and improved symptom control.

Understanding the Importance of Progesterone in Women’s Hormone Therapy

Progesterone plays a vital role in counterbalancing estrogen effects and supporting menstrual health, mood stability, and bone density. In BHRT, ensuring adequate progesterone levels is crucial to reduce risks such as endometrial hyperplasia and to enhance symptom relief.

Many women benefit from bioidentical progesterone supplementation, which differs from synthetic progestins by more closely mimicking natural hormone action. Personalized dosing administered by a menopause treatment clinic allows for optimized therapeutic outcomes and minimized side effects.
